Please read the reviews and take for consideration on all the bad experiences most customers mentioned. The massage was absolutely terrible. I was also asked to over tip and it was approached like it was required. It was a complete waste of money in my opinion. Really felt like I was taken advantage of. My entire massage was done with one hand on top of that cause she couldn't use the other due an Injury but why didn't you tell me that when I booked the reservation. Wouldn't ever come back.

I've been going here for many years and I just felt that I had to write a review at this point. Apple is hands down the BEST masseuse out there. I always go out of my way to come here just to see her. Her massages are always consistently amazing. she can go from gentle to strong massage, however you like it. I don't know how she does it, but she always manages to fit in a hot stone session into the massage as well. She always goes above and beyond to please. Hands down the best massage in queens
